Post Can't take the sunroof off

I've been wondering about this ever since i got my car. I've read the manual several times. The sunroof can pop up but i can't take the damn thing off. I know how to take it off but the mechanism won't unlock even at the position the factory says the key should be at. Is there a short? loose wire? electrical problem????? I'd like to find out before I go autocrossing again this weekend.

Mine had the same problem, but with an additional twist, the clutch on the motor was slipping. (Yes, there is a clutch on it.) After checking the microswitch at the front, I started checking the motor and limit switches in the back. Reset the clutch back to the proper tension and reset the limit switches, no more problem.

Go to the tech articles section; there is a great post about sunroof operation.

When you take the cover off to get to the sunroof "stuff", you will see two limit switches on top. The bottom one is for the sunroof to stop at close, the top one is the one that may need adjustment to let your roof know to "open". The front tab on your sunroof also functions as a open/close contact. I've heard of people doing away with this switch and butt splicing it.

AT worst case it could be your ignition switch or sunroof switch, since you have to be at position one to take the roof out, but not likely.
